Position Title: Program Support Specialist
Constellation is seeking a Program Support Specialist to join our Homeland Security team in Washington, DC. This is a full-time, onsite position supporting day-to-day administrative, scheduling, logistics, and program coordination activities within a federal office environment. This position is responsible for providing administrative and operational support within the office, with a focus on filing, data entry, scheduling, and correspondence. This role also leads the managing program schedules and coordinate meetings using Microsoft Outlook and Teams, promptly resolving scheduling conflicts.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ist with logistics and coordination of internal training, workshops, tasker responses.
  • Regularly review SharePoint site to identify and implement necessary updates.
  • Draft and edit correspondence, briefs, and reports with discretion and tactful judgment.
  • Coordinate and assist with the movement of government assets, including office equipment, supplies, and materials.
  • Communicate with staff and departments to fulfill logistical and administrative needs.
  • Monitor supply levels and assist with ordering and restocking supplies as needed.
  • Provide calendar and meeting support, including scheduling, agenda preparation, and note taking for staff meetings and office projects.
  • Provide support for maintaining the organizational source requests utilizing a centralized tracker to meet operational needs.
  • Monitor and respond to routine inquiries via the shared email box or phone, escalating when necessary to the senior leadership.
The ideal candidate must have the following experience, background, and credentials:
  • A minimum of three (3) years of experience in a business/administrative support role.
  • Ability to follow safety procedures and handle equipment responsibly.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Human Resource Management, or a related field.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(SharePoint,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int, Power BI).
  • Be a U.S. citizen able to pass a background investigation by the client agency. DHS clearance with CBP or DoD Top-Secret preferred.
